Portuguese outfit Vitoria Guimaraes considering loan move for Alhassan Wakaso

Portuguese side Vitoria Guimaraes are considering a loan move for Alhassan Wakaso in the ongoing summer transfer window, according to media reports.

Wakaso, who joined French side Lorient on a three-and-a-half-year deal from Portuguese Liga NOS outfit Rio Ave during the winter transfer window, is seeking to depart the club following their demotion to Ligue 2 last term.

The 25-year-old has emerged as a prime target for the Guimaraes-based as they augment their squad ahead of the coming top-flight season.

Wakaso is also reported to be a target for fellow Portuguese outfit Portimonense in the ongoing summer transfer window but Guimaraes could steal a match on the newly promoted side.

Alhassan Wakaso is the younger brother of Black Stars midfielder Mubarak Wakaso.
